Conan Gray was born in Lemon Grove, California, on December 5, 1998, and raised in Georgetown, Texas.
He began uploading vlogs, covers, and original songs to YouTube as a youngster. 2018 saw Gray sign a record deal with Republic Records, which led to the release of his first EP, Sunset Season.

His college education was supposed to have taken place at UCLA but he dropped it to pursue his music career.
Gray is frequently praised for his understanding of nostalgia connected to Americana. He has made music recordings, art exhibits, and other films for his vlog that have received more than 25 million views.
In March 2017, Gray independently released his first single, Idle Town. On Spotify, the song received over 14 million streams, while 12 million people watched it on YouTube.
The track Generation Why by Gray was made available on Republic Records in October 2018.
